Output 06025d777e336385ca6a184a14353c0986bcae95f569a6a671f86e04fec95e90:1

value
467692
script pubkey
OP_0 OP_PUSHBYTES_20 58b66c61de95c9a70f0f3bdb40b4d7c17b96e2bb
address
bc1qtzmxccw7jhy6wrc080d5pdxhc9aedc4mg04a5s
transaction
06025d777e336385ca6a184a14353c0986bcae95f569a6a671f86e04fec95e90
confirmations
128607
spent
true